Abstract
The invention relates to a method for producing a beverage in portions, wherein a beverage concentrate portion is mixed with a water portion, said water portion being mixed with carbon dioxide prior to being mixed with the beverage concentrate. The invention additionally relates to a device for producing a beverage in portions, wherein a beverage concentrate portion is mixed with a water portion, said water portion being mixed with carbon dioxide in a static mixer prior to being mixed with the beverage concentrate.
Claims
1. A method for portionwise preparation of a beverage comprising: a) admixing a portion of water with carbon dioxide in a static mixer at a positive pressure of about 7 bar or greater; b) mixing a portion of beverage concentrate with the portion of water; wherein the portion of water is admixed with carbon dioxide prior to mixing with the beverage concentrate; and, wherein a compensator is provided downstream of the static mixer.
2.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the water is provided at a temperature of 0° C. to about −10° C. prior to mixing with carbon dioxide.
3. (canceled)
4.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ein a flow rate in the static mixer is about 3 m/s to about −8 m/s.
5. (canceled)
6.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ein a reduced pressure compared to operating conditions is present in the static mixer before and after the preparation of the portion of water.
7.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ein a ratio of an amount of water to an amount of carbon dioxide is regulated.
8. A device for portionwise preparation of a beverage comprising: a) a cartridge containing a portion of beverage concentrate; b) a water tank containing water; c) a static mixer having multiple mixer stages; and d) a compensator downstream of the static mixer; wherein a portion of the beverage concentrate is mixed with a portion of the water; and wherein the portion of water is admixed with carbon dioxide in the static mixer prior to mixing with the beverage concentrate.
9. The device as claimed in claim 8, wherein the exit of a downstream mixer stage forms a nozzle for an upstream mixer stage adjacent thereto.
10. The device as claimed in claim 8, wherein a flow cross section of the static mixer decreases in the direction of flow.
11. The device as claimed in claim 10, wherein the flow cross section decreases in steps.
12. (canceled)
13. The device as claimed in claim 8, wherein the compensator has an inlet and an outlet, and the outlet is offset from a longitudinal central axis of the compensator.
14. The device as claimed in claim 8, wherein the compensator has a housing, wherein within the housing is a fitted element having a conical section and a cylindrical section, wherein the cylindrical section has provided thereon projections and/or indentations, the length of which in a longitudinal direction is at most 40% of a length of the cylindrical part.
15. The device as claimed in claim 14, wherein the conical part has provided thereon ribs.
16. The method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the admixing with carbon dioxide is done at a positive pressure of greater than about 8 bar.
17. The method as claimed in claim 16, wherein the admixing with carbon dioxide is done at a positive pressure of about 9 bar to about 11 bar.
18. The method as claimed in claim 2, wherein the water is provided at a temperature of 0° C. to about 4° C. prior to mixing with carbon dioxide.
19. The method as claimed in claim 6, wherein the reduced pressure is ambient pressure.
20. The device as claimed in claim 13, wherein the outlet is eccentric to the longitudinal axis of the compensator.
21. The device as claimed in claim 13, wherein the compensator has a housing, wherein within the housing is a fitted element having a conical section and a cylindrical section, wherein the cylindrical section has provided thereon projections and/or indentations, the length of which in a longitudinal direction is at most 40% of a length of the cylindrical part.
22. The device as claimed in claim 21, wherein the conical part has provided thereon ribs.
23. The device as claimed in claim 15, wherein the ribs are elastic.
